WATERRA INERTIAL PUMPS - HIGH FLOW SYSTEM

This is our largest tubing and valve system for use where higher pumping rates are required. The system is typically used in 100mm and larger boreholes to a maximum depth of 40 metres. Manual operation is possible to approximately 10 metres, but it is best operated mechanically with the PowerPack PP1. If water levels are within suction depth, pumping can be carried out in conjunction with the SP1 suction pump.
Maximum flow rate (under ideal conditions) is between 10 and 15 litres per minute.
The system can also be used for cleaning and development of 50mm diameter monitoring boreholes using a Waterra Surge Disc.

Surge Blocks for High Flow System Tubing (48mm OD)

Delrin Surge Blocks are used in 50mm diameter boreholes to enhance borehole development and remove sediment. The combination of mechanical surging and high volume pumping can remove water containing silt and fine sand without clogging. Add water to the borehole if necessary to loosen silt.
The SBHF Surge Block fits over the High Flow tubing and is held in place with a stainless steel grub screw directly above the Waterra foot valve.

WATERRA INERTIAL PUMPS - STANDARD SYSTEM

This is our most popular pumping system for use in 50mm diameter monitoring boreholes but can also be used in boreholes from 30 to 100 mm in diameter. Manual operation is possible to approximately 15 metres, but it is best operated mechanically with the PowerPack PP1 which can extend the pumping range to over 60 metres (85 metres using STDX tubing). If water levels are within suction depth, pumping can be carried out in conjunction with the SP1 suction pump.
Maximum flow rate (under ideal conditions) is between 6 and 8 litres per minute.
The system can also be used for cleaning and development of 50mm diameter monitoring boreholes using a Waterra Surge Disc.

WATERRA INERTIAL PUMPS - LOW FLOW SYSTEM

This pumping system is highly recommended for purging and sampling from 17 to 19mm ID piezometer tubes. It can be operated manually to approximately 30m achieving flow rates of up to 1.5 l/min.

WATERRA INERTIAL PUMPS - SUPER-MICRO FLOW SYSTEM

This pumping system is normally used for purging and sampling from 10mm ID piezometer tubes. It can be operated manually to approximately 30m achieving flow rates of up to 0.3 l/min.
It is commonly used for sampling from multi-level borehole such as the CMT system an dcan be mechanically operated with the PowerPack PP1 using an adaptor clamp.

Volatile Sampling Tubing

A 6mm diameter siphon tube (VSK-30) can be used to collect samples from inertial pump tubing to avoid sample contact with air at surface and provide a smooth laminar flow of water. Tubing can be supplied in HDPE or Teflon.
The technique is best carried out using Standard Waterra tubing, though it is also possible with High Flow Waterra tubing.
